Conditioned Stimulus
Within classical conditioning, an initially neutral stimulus becomes linked with an unconditioned stimulus and ultimately elicits a conditioned response.
Neutral Stimulus
In conditioning, a stimulus that initially elicits no specific response other than focusing attention, which can eventually elicit a conditioned response when paired with an unconditioned stimulus.
